Colebrook River Lake

U.S. Army Corps of Engineers

Search Riverton Connecticut

Colebrook River Lake is located on the Farmington River in Colebrook, Connecticut, and is a part of a network of flood control dams on tributaries of the Connecticut River. Completed in 1969 at a cost of $14.3 million, the amount of water stored at Colebrook River Lake can fluctuate substantially. The pool, used for both water supply and fishery habitat, normally covers an area of about 750 acres. Colebrook River Lake can store up to 16.56 billion gallons of water for flood control purposes. In a time of high water, the gates are lowered in order to hold back the water, only to be released when downstream river conditions begin to recede.

The 388 acres of federal lands are managed for both recreation and for the the benefit of forest and wildlife resources. Wildlife food plots, nesting boxes, open area patch mowing and forest thinning are several techniques used to provide wildlife with food, cover and nesting habitat.
